Kubota L4350 Battery Size (Group 31) + Replacement Guide

Quick answer:

The Kubota L4350 tractor battery specs found are Group 31, 12 V (verify with operator manual), 600 CCA, 13 × 6.81 × 9.44 in.

Battery sizeGroup 31
Voltage12 V (verify with operator manual)
CCA600 CCA
Case size13 × 6.81 × 9.44 in

Kubota L4350 Battery Specs

Battery size / group Group 31
Battery voltage 12 V (verify with operator manual)
Battery CCA 600 CCA
Battery dimensions 13 × 6.81 × 9.44 in
Battery location The battery on the Kubota L4350 tractor is located on the left side of the transmission housing, on the operator platform.

Kubota L4350 Battery FAQ

Replacement battery recommendation For the Kubota L4350 tractor, use a battery that matches Group 31, 600 CCA or higher, case size around 13 × 6.81 × 9.44 in. Also match the terminal layout, hold-down style and battery tray clearance before buying. A 12 V battery is shown as a fallback, so verify the voltage in the operator manual before ordering.

Battery replacement steps When swapping the Kubota L4350 battery, match the replacement to 13 × 6.81 × 9.44 in and keep the same terminal layout. Shut the tractor down fully, remove negative first and positive second. After the new battery is seated and clamped, connect the positive cable first, followed by the negative cable.
Bad battery symptoms When the Kubota L4350 battery no longer holds charge, you may see slow cranking, dim lamps, weak accessory power or a starter that clicks instead of turning the engine over.
